Output 129ee4751e9d54f299fcfb836be38433bbbb1bf61790fa5ea20362b34c99da8a:20

value
19815234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41175aa876581b8fb2f04d32ecaa28a821031416 OP_EQUAL
address
37dBpgm771sdTSRmcSoCRbzNqwvHVbH2fa
transaction
129ee4751e9d54f299fcfb836be38433bbbb1bf61790fa5ea20362b34c99da8a
confirmations
213552
spent
true